Inner elbow pain from KB training. Anyone actually get past this? by penguinblanket in kettlebell

[–]curwalker 0 points1 point  (0 children)

This seemed to work for me too, unless it just healed spontaneously concurrent with the massage protocol, who knows......

Anyway I would just put a lacrosse ball on a table and roll my forearm around on the tender spots. It hurts and "feels good" at the same time.

Alibaba adjustable kettlebell "review" by Minimum-Perception72 in kettlebell

[–]curwalker 5 points6 points  (0 children)

For the weights that rattle, like 20kg: if you put a bigger plate in first, the outer circular edge of that plate will snug against the inner sphere of the shell. Then you stack smaller plates on top of that bigger plate, tighten the bolt hard, and no rattling.
